Dacic warns Serbia to respond to Kosovo's halt campaign for recognition

Serbia's Foreign Minister, Ivica Dacic, said Serbia will soon have an answer for Kosovo that is continuing to lobby for recognition of independence, as Prime Minister Avdullah Hoti said such a process has not stopped. He said that in an agreement with Serbian President Aleksandar Vuciq they will have an answer ready, Klan Kosova reports.

 

 

Daciq is saying he was not surprised by Hoti's statement and reminded that Belgrade, shortly after special envoy Richard Grenelli's announcement, voiced doubt that Pristina would respect the agreement to give up the lobby.

“They lie throughout the dialogue, lying is the basis of their existence. They do not want any agreement or compromise, they just want Serbia to recognise Kosovo”, Dacic told Sputnik.

He stressed that such behaviour is absolutely unacceptable to Serbia.

Dacic referred to a Twitter post on June 15th that Kosovo and Serbia have agreed to stop the evaluation campaign.

Great news! I have taken the commitment from the governments of Kosovo and Serbia that they will temporarily stop the recognition campaign and the application for international membership so that we can meet in Washington, DC at the White House on 27 June for discussions on dialogue”, Grenelli wrote.
